From: Michael B. Trausch Date: Sun, 7 Sep 2014 01:39:40 +0000 (-0400) Subject: windows: -no-undefined is required to make a DLL. X-Git-Tag: libserialport-0.1.1~99 X-Git-Url: http://sigrok.org/gitweb/?p=libserialport.git;a=commitdiff_plain;h=da8730199a215c9ccd938202fb55ac9e3f58a0b2 windows: -no-undefined is required to make a DLL. --- diff --git a/Makefile.am b/Makefile.am index 33d1704..93bd793 100644 --- a/Makefile.am +++ b/Makefile.am @@ -37,12 +37,13 @@ endif libserialport_la_LIBADD = $(LIBOBJS) +libserialport_la_LDFLAGS = $(SP_LIB_LDFLAGS) + if WIN32 libserialport_la_LIBADD += -lsetupapi +libserialport_la_LDFLAGS += -no-undefined endif -libserialport_la_LDFLAGS = $(SP_LIB_LDFLAGS) - library_includedir = $(includedir) library_include_HEADERS = libserialport.h